There are at least three bands with the name the Tigers. The most widely known of these are The Tigers (ザ・タイガース), who were Japan’s most popular band of the Group Sounds era. The group featured a singer named Kenji Sawada, and were signed to Watanabe Productions. The group was first named Funnys and was formed in 1966. They changed their name to "The Tigers" on their first TV performance on 15 November 1966. They appeared in several Japanese movies in the late 1960s. The Soft Boys were a post-punk/neo-psychedelic band which formed in 1976 in Cambridge, England. The band's best known lineup consisted of Robyn Hitchcock (vocals, guitar), Kimberley Rew (guitar), Matthew Seligman (bass) and Morris Windsor (drums). Seligman replaced original bassist Andy Metcalfe in 1979, and two guitarists (Rob Lamb and Alan Davies) briefly preceded Rew. The band issued two albums, A Can of Bees (1979) and Underwater Moonlight (1980), before splitting in 1980. Curtis Stigers (* 18. Oktober 1965 in Boise, Idaho, USA) ist ein US-amerikanischer Sänger und Saxophonist. Seine größten Erfolge feierte er Anfang der 1990er mit der Pop-Ballade I Wonder Why, ein internationaler Top-Ten-Hit (1991 US Platz 9, UK Platz 5, D Platz 8), und You're All That Matters To Me (1992, UK Platz 6). Beide Titel entstammen seiner Debüt-LP Curtis Stigers (1991), welche ihm mehrere Platin-Auszeichnungen in aller Welt einbrachte. Insgesamt verkaufte sich das Album weltweit über anderthalb Millionen Mal.
